    Ingredients

    Potatoes, Vegetable Oil (Contains One Or More Of The Following: Canola, Palm, Soybean, Sunflower), Salt, Disodium Dihydrogen Pyrophosphate (To Promote Color Retention), Dextrose, Coloring (Caramel, Annatto, Turmeric).

    Allergens and safety warnings

    Keep frozen. Do not thaw. For food safety, product must be cooked thoroughly before eating. Fries must reach a minimum of 165°F (74°C) internal temperature as measured by a food thermometer in several spots.
